Can This Rotten Toy Hauler Be Rescued?
The owner of this Weekend Warrior Toy hauler have been asking me for the last 5 years to repair the rotten roof on the back of the 5th wheel. I have politely begged not to, as I have had too many unhappy experiences re-building original Weekend Warrior trailers. But somehow, they talked me into doing it. Now I will not say we are re-building the RV back to showroom standards, but a house with a rotten and leaking roof is hardly useful. So join me as we start the budget re-build on this Weekend Warrior and hopefully, give a few more years of life to a dune loving machine.
